65 |
*/ |
*/ |
66 |
if (pthread_equal( params->tid, father_id)) { |
if (pthread_equal( params->tid, father_id)) { |
67 |
#endif |
#endif |
68 |
|
/* Calculate current time. Moved here, so only one thread |
69 |
|
* calls this. |
70 |
|
*/ |
71 |
|
time(¤t_time); |
72 |
|
|
73 |
if (params->sighup_flag) |
if (params->sighup_flag) |
74 |
sighup_run(); |
sighup_run(); |
75 |
if (params->sigalrm_flag) |
if (params->sigalrm_flag) |
123 |
} |
} |
124 |
} |
} |
125 |
|
|
|
time(¤t_time); |
|
126 |
if (params->server_s[0].socket != -1 && FD_ISSET(params->server_s[0].socket, ¶ms->block_read_fdset)) |
if (params->server_s[0].socket != -1 && FD_ISSET(params->server_s[0].socket, ¶ms->block_read_fdset)) |
127 |
params->server_s[0].pending_requests = 1; |
params->server_s[0].pending_requests = 1; |
128 |
#ifdef ENABLE_SSL |
#ifdef ENABLE_SSL |